> > Hi,
> > Daniel Berrangé has proposed a release schedule that looks good to me.
> > The release will happen just before the KVM Forum conference.
> >
> > Please reply if you have any questions or concerns about these dates!
> >
> > - Soft freeze: 2025-07-22
> > - Hard freeze (rc0): 2025-07-29
> > - rc1: 2025-08-05
> > - rc2: 2025-08-12
> > - rc3: 2025-08-19
> > - Release or rc4: 2025-08-26
> > - Release if rc4 was needed: 2025-09-02
> >
> > https://wiki.qemu.org/Planning/10.1
>
> Personally if I were running the release this time around I
> would move everything a week earlier, to avoid the potential
> need to do a release the week of KVM Forum. (My experience is
> that "we need an rc4" is the common case.)

I was waiting to see if there were any other thoughts about the QEMU
10.1 schedule.

Let's move the schedule forward by 1 week to leave some breathing room
before KVM Forum. Thanks for the suggestion, Peter!
